Ticket — VerdaGrow greenhouse controller: humidity sensor drift. Over roughly three weeks, the Bay 4 unit's readings drifted +6% RH versus the calibrated reference, causing the misting loop to underrun. For the security review: the drift correction table is fetched over an unauthenticated local endpoint, so a spoofed table could silently skew climate control. Requesting signed calibration payloads in the next firmware. The affected firmware's build token appears below.

trace token, fafog-kageg: htk4_98e6

## Runbook: Bounce Processor Stalls

When the Pelicanmail bounce processor falls behind, the backlog gauge on the Driftboard climbs past 10k. First, confirm the classifier workers are alive; restart any that show heartbeat gaps over five minutes. Hard bounces re-queue automatically, soft bounces age out after 72 hours. If the backlog keeps growing after a restart, escalate to the delivery team and include the token printed below in your ticket.

session token of yajof-bagef = htk4_937d

// Tile prefetcher client setup.
// Prefetches map tiles around the user's viewport from the Glimmerpath
// tile service. Radius is two zoom levels out; don't widen it without
// checking quota with the infra crew. Cache lives in /var/cache/glimmer
// and evicts LRU at 2 GB. Failures are non-fatal — the renderer falls
// back to on-demand fetches. Client needs an auth key for the internal
// tile service; the current one is on the next line.

gateway credential: kto3_qfe

Finance Review Summary — Customer Concentration, Verelux Group

Revenue concentration remains elevated: the Dunmoor account represents 31% of recurring income, up from 26% last year. Two further accounts together add 18%. Contract renewal timing clusters in the second quarter, compounding exposure. Heads of department should factor this into hiring and inventory commitments. Mitigation options are under review, and the confidential note below sets out the plan.

internal memo for faweg-hahip: Silokix Works plans to lower the Tamvan list price by 8 percent in June.